ALEXANDRIA, Va., March 17 -- United States Patent no. 12,580,209, issued on March 17, was assigned to SUMITOMO ELECTRIC INDUSTRIES LTD. (Osaka, Japan).
"Redox flow battery" was invented by Hirokazu Kaku (Osaka, Japan) and Ryouta Tatsumi (Osaka, Japan).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A redox flow battery includes a positive electrolyte containing a positive electrode active material and a negative electrolyte containing a negative electrode active material. A liquid amount of the positive electrolyte is different from a liquid amount of the negative electrolyte.
